Web18 feb. 2024 · A Type 2 tag has its data pages starting at page/block 4. Data is embedded into TLV structures. In your case, the first byte of page 4 is the tag of an NDEF Message TLV (0x03). The next byte indicates that the length filed is encoded in 3-byte format. Consequently, the length is 0x015A (= 346 bytes). WebDe MIFARE Ultralight-kaarten hebben 64 bytes, zonder beveiliging. Dit type kaart is dusdanig goedkoop dat het dikwijls wordt gebruikt bij wegwerpkaarten, zoals voetbaltickets. MIFARE DESFire. De MIFARE DESFire-kaarten hebben een geheugen van 2, 4 of 8 kilobytes, met een DES, 3DES of AES beveiliging.
